That afternoon, the atmosphere between Leng Nuan and Lu Benlai remained amicable.
Before they left the Forbidden City, Lu Benlai patiently accompanied Leng Nuan as they shopped around the shops in the Forbidden City to pick out some accessories.
There was no parking in the vicinity of Changan Street, so Lu Benlai and Leng Nuan had to walk for roughly half an hour before they reached the parking lot.
It was already dinnertime, so when Lu Benlai opened the car door for Leng Nuan, he asked casually, "Shall we go for Hunan cuisine?"
"Sure …" That was Leng Nuan's favorite flavor.
Back then, Leng Nuan and Lu Benlai were still fine. Even when they went to the restaurant they frequented, Lu Benlai only ordered Leng Nuan's favorite dishes. Even after the waiter left, Lu Benlai still acted like a competent boyfriend, helping Leng Nuan remove the disposable chopsticks and the wet paper towels … Everything was still fine.
By the time they were done with their meal, it was already around eight in the evening. Leng Nuan was indeed a little tired after strolling around the Forbidden City for the entire afternoon. After settling the bill, Lu Benlai asked her where she wanted to go, and she replied, "I want to go home."
Lu Benlai replied with a "Alright". When they reached the first floor of the restaurant, he had Leng Nuan wait for him for a moment before heading to the washroom.
There were people entering and leaving the restaurant one after another. Leng Nuan didn't pay much attention to her surroundings. She was browsing through her unread messages on her phone, and it was only when she felt that it was about time that she raised her head to look in the direction of the washroom. Seeing that Lu Benlai hadn't come out yet, she retracted her gaze and turned back to her phone. However, just as she was about to leap past the entrance of the restaurant, she caught sight of a familiar figure.
Her fingers trembled, and the phone fell to the ground with a thud.
It was as if she had just received a huge fright. Her mind was at a complete loss, and she panicked until Lu Benlai's voice sounded behind her, "Nuannuan?"
Noticing Leng Nuan's ghastly pale face, Lu Benlai's expression also turned grim, "What's wrong?"
It was only then that Leng Nuan raised her head to look at Lu Benlai. After a moment of composure, she shook her head and said, "N-nothing …"
"Then why do you look so pale? Also, why did your phone fall to the ground? "Lu Benlai asked as he bent down to pick up Leng Nuan's phone.
The screen shattered …
Seeing that Leng Nuan's complexion was still a little awful, Lu Benlai thought that she was feeling distressed over her phone, so he said, "It's fine, it's not too late anyway. Let's take a detour to a phone shop on the way home and pick a new one …"
Leng Nuan didn't understand what Lu Benlai was saying at all, so she simply nodded her head. Seeing that he was walking toward the door, she followed suit.
Just as she was about to step out of the restaurant, she suddenly recalled the familiar figure who had just disappeared from the restaurant, and she halted her footsteps. Through the glass door, she stared fearfully at the figure outside for quite some time. It wasn't until Lu Benlai walked out of the restaurant that he noticed that she wasn't coming out, that he turned to look at her and asked, "Nuannuan, why aren't you coming out?"
Only then did Leng Nuan raise her feet and walk out of the dining hall. By the time she reached the entrance, she realized that the familiar figure was long gone, and she heaved a sigh of relief.
In the end, instead of buying a new phone, Leng Nuan returned home.
She maintained a calm demeanor as she bade farewell to Lu Benlai at the entrance of the rented apartment. A second after Lu Benlai stepped into the elevator, she closed the door and picked up her phone to check the calendar.
